The local picture

Roof Replacement in Cobb Island: what matters

Cobb Island sits on the Potomac River in Charles County, where the climate brings a mix of humid summers, nor'easters, and occasional tropical storms. Many homes here were built as seasonal cottages and later converted to year-round residences, meaning roofing materials may be older or not originally designed for full-time occupancy. If your roof is showing signs of wear—curled shingles, leaks, or granule loss—replacement is a significant investment. Understanding the local factors that influence cost can help you plan. This guide covers what Cobb Island homeowners should know about roof replacement, from material choices to contractor selection, without focusing on specific prices.

Cost factors

Why Roof Replacement Costs Vary in Cobb Island

Several factors unique to Cobb Island affect roof replacement costs. The region's humidity and salt air from the Potomac can accelerate shingle deterioration, often requiring more durable materials like architectural asphalt or metal. Hail and high winds from summer storms can cause granule loss and lifting, leading to earlier replacement. Many homes have low-slope or flat roofs, which demand specialized installation methods and materials. Maryland's building code requires proper underlayment and ventilation, adding to labor and material costs. Older homes may need decking repairs or upgrades to meet current code. Disposal fees and permit costs from the local building department also factor into the total. Finally, labor rates in Charles County reflect the seasonal demand and availability of skilled crews.

Field notes

Common Reasons Cobb Island Roofs Need Replacement

  1. Hail Damage

    Hailstorms can bruise asphalt shingles, causing granule loss and exposing the mat. Over time, this leads to leaks and accelerated aging, especially on older roofs.

  2. Wind Lifting

    Strong winds from nor'easters and thunderstorms can lift shingle edges, allowing water to seep underneath. Repeated lifting weakens sealant bonds and may require full replacement.

  3. UV Degradation

    Intense summer sun causes asphalt shingles to dry out, crack, and lose flexibility. This is common on south- and west-facing slopes in Cobb Island.

  4. Moss and Algae Growth

    Humidity and shade from trees promote moss and algae, which trap moisture against shingles. Over time, this can lift shingles and degrade the roofing material.

  5. Age and Wear

    Many Cobb Island homes have original roofs from the 1990s or earlier. Asphalt shingles typically last 20–30 years, so aging roofs often need replacement before leaks develop.

What factors affect roof replacement cost in Cobb Island?

Cost depends on roof size, slope, material choice, and accessibility. Steep or complex roofs require more labor and safety equipment. Material prices vary: asphalt is generally more budget-friendly, while metal or slate cost more. Local labor rates in Charles County, permit fees, and disposal costs also play a role. The condition of the existing decking may add to the total if repairs are needed. Your contractor can provide a detailed estimate after an inspection.

How do I choose a roofing contractor in Cobb Island?

Look for a contractor licensed in Maryland and insured with liability and workers' compensation. Ask for references from recent local jobs and check online reviews. Get multiple written estimates that detail materials, labor, and timeline. Avoid contractors who demand full payment upfront. A reliable contractor will explain the process and answer your questions without pressure.

What are Maryland's licensing requirements for roofers?

Maryland requires roofers to hold a Home Improvement license from the Maryland Home Improvement Commission (MHIC). This license ensures the contractor meets state standards for insurance and business practices. You can verify a license on the MHIC website. Local permits may also be required by the Charles County permitting office.

When is the ideal time to replace a roof in Cobb Island?

Late spring through early fall offers the most consistent weather for roof replacement. Temperatures are moderate, and rain is less frequent than in winter. However, scheduling in advance is wise, as contractors are busiest during these months. Winter replacements are possible but may face delays due to cold or precipitation.

Do I need a permit for roof replacement in Cobb Island?

Yes, most roof replacements in Charles County require a building permit from the local building department. The permit ensures the work meets Maryland's building code for wind resistance, underlayment, and ventilation. Your contractor typically handles the permit application and inspection scheduling.
